Operations Specialist – Group Internal Projects
As Operations Specialist – Group Internal Projects (GIP) you will support the effective delivery of our internal projects by enabling project managers with standards, tools, insights, and governance. You act as a central point of expertise for project management methodologies, reporting, and PM/PPM tool operations, ensuring transparency, consistency, and data quality across the project portfolio; responsibilities include, but are not limited to:
What makes your job exciting:
Guide and support Project Managers in the consistent application of project management standards, including planning, forecasting, risk and issue management, and status reporting
Deliver onboarding sessions and ongoing training for Project Managers on project management methodologies, processes, and tools.
Ensure the consistent adoption and continuous improvement of defined project management standards and methodologies across all internal projects.
Operate and administer PM/PPM tools (currently MS Azure DevOps), including configuration, integrations, and user support.
Prepare and maintain regular project and portfolio reports, status dashboards, and KPIs; support the preparation of decision and recommendation papers for management.
Ensure completeness, accuracy, and consistency of project and portfolio data and all related reporting.
Your Talents:
Higher education, preferably with an IT degree
Solid experience in a PMO, project coordination, or project support role, ideally in a multi-project or portfolio environment.
Strong knowledge of project management standards and methodologies (e.g. PMI, PRINCE2, Agile/Hybrid), with the ability to translate them into practical guidance.
Hands-on experience with PM/PPM tools (e.g. Azure DevOps, MS Project, Jira, or similar), including configuration and reporting.
Strong analytical and reporting skills, with proven ability to create clear dashboards, KPIs, and management-ready reports.
Experience in delivering trainings, onboarding sessions, or workshops to project managers or stakeholders.
Strong attention to detail and data accuracy.
Feeling comfortable working in interdisciplinary teams.
Very good command of English - German language skills (as a plus)
